What were the similar right sand status the Rome citizen sand the allies of Rome had?

History
1 answer:
erastovalidia [21]2 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Every citizen, women excluded, shared fully in all governmental activities with all of its rights, privileges, and responsibilities. It should be noted that Roman women were considered citizens; however, they had few, if any, legal rights.

What are the arguments for deregulation of the economy ?
Lerok [7]

Answer:

Deregulation has many advantages, which vary by industry. Some of the main advantages are: It generally lowers barriers to entry into industries, which assists with improving innovation, entrepreneurship, competition, and efficiency; this leads to lower prices for customers and improved quality.
